20 most stressed, 20 least stressed counties January 12th, 2011 @ 1:09pm By The Associated Press


(AP) - Here are the 20 most economically stressed counties with populations of at least 25,000 and their November 2010 Stress scores, according to The Associated Press Economic Stress Index:
1. Imperial County, Calif., 33.15
2. Yuma County, Ariz., 26.91
3. Lyon County, Nev., 26.75
4. Nye County, Nev., 25.21
5. Yuba County, Calif., 24.18
6. Merced County, Calif., 23.98
7. Sutter County, Calif., 23.65
8. San Joaquin County, Calif., 23.46
9. Clark County, Nev., 23.4
10. Lake County, Calif., 23.33
11. Stanislaus County, Calif., 23.06
12. San Benito County, Calif., 22
13. Flagler County, Fla., 21.46
14. Riverside County, Calif., 21.32
15. Hendry County, Fla., 21.18
16. Madera County, Calif., 20.89
17. Fresno County, Calif., 20.86
18. St. Lucie County, Fla., 20.79
19. Santa Cruz County, Ariz., 20.68
20. Osceola County, Fla., 20.65
A list of the 20 least economically stressed counties with populations of at least 25,000 and their November 2010 Stress scores, according to The Associated Press Economic Stress Index:
1. Ward County, N.D., 3.29
2. Sioux County, Iowa, 3.71
3. Buffalo County, Neb., 3.74
4. Brown County, S.D., 3.96
5. Brookings County, S.D., 3.98
6. Ellis County, Kan., 3.98
7. Burleigh County, N.D., 4.04
8. Grand Forks County, N.D., 4.06
9. Madison County, Neb., 4.31
10. Ford County, Kan., 4.38
11. Codington County, S.D., 4.4
12. Cass County, N.D., 4.42
13. Albany County, Wyo., 4.55
14. Arlington County, Va., 4.6
15. Lancaster County, Neb., 4.74
16. Morton County, N.D., 4.84
17. Lincoln County, S.D., 4.85
18. Platte County, Neb., 4.88
19. Adams County, Neb., 4.88
20. Lincoln County, Neb., 4.96
